Abstract

The invention relates to a refrigeratory for keeping fresh of farm and sideline products, in concrete a high humidity forestless refrigeratory, which comprises a refrigeration compressor unit, an air cooling machine (1), a liquid storage pond (3), a circulating pump (4) and a shower (5), etc. The liquid storage pond (3) is arranged at bottom in a refrigeratory (2), which is internally placed with solution with low freezing point; a liquid inlet of the circulating pump (4) extends into the solution with low freezing point in the liquid storage pond (3) through pipelines and a liquid outlet of the circulating pump (4) is communicated with the shower (5) which is arranged at upper side of the air cooling machine (1) in the refrigeratory (2) and is able to spraying the perisporium in the air cooling machine (1) and the refrigeratory (2). The invention is characterized by large amount of solution with low freezing point stored, large volume of cold stored, convenient adjustment for concentration of the solution, forestless of air cooling machine evaporator, good refrigeration effect, high humidity in the refrigeratory and capability of lowering energy consumed, etc.

Description

A kind of high-wetness frostless cool house
One, technical field:
The present invention relates to the freezer that a kind of agricultural byproducts preservation and freshness is used, specifically a kind of high-wetness frostless cool house.
Two, background technology:
The freezer frosting be since the temperature of freezer about 0 ℃ or below 0 ℃, the surface of air-cooler evaporimeter often is lower than the temperature of freezer, just can adsorb moisture in the freezer and frosting, thereby heat transfer efficiency is reduced, the heat exchange weak effect, storehouse temperature drop temperature speed is slow, and energy consumption increases; When frosting was serious, the heat exchange effect reduced greatly, and Ku Wen no longer descends, and cold-producing medium evaporation simultaneously is not enough, caused the liquid hammer fault of refrigeration compressor set outside the storehouse.At present, freezer all is provided with defrosting device at the air-cooler of sub-zero temperature operation both at home and abroad, as hot water defrosting, the defrost of cold-producing medium backheat, electricity-heated defrosting etc., all needs the operation of high temperature and frequent warehouse-in.And the process of defrost is the inverse process of refrigeration, need expend the cold of a large amount of freezers, the heat of bringing freezer simultaneously into can make the temperature in the freezer rise, cause the fluctuation of storehouse temperature, particularly middle-size and small-size freezer, the fluctuation of temperature can reach more than 10 ℃, has seriously influenced the fresh-keeping effect and the quality of repertory.
Utilize low freezing point solution dash to drench the evaporator surface device frosting that can avoid evaporating immediately, low freezing point solution in use needs to carry out concentration adjustment.Useful fluid storage tank with the air-cooler one is stored and is regulated low freezing point solution in prior art, and this all-in-one is suitable for small-sized air-cooler, uses on bigger air-cooler, often off-capacity and adjusting inconvenience.
Three, summary of the invention:
The purpose of this invention is to provide a kind of high-wetness frostless cool house.The storage liquid measure of its low freezing point solution is big, and cold storage capacity is big, and the concentration adjustment of low freezing point solution is convenient, and the air-cooler evaporimeter does not have frosting, good refrigeration effect, and humidity height in the storehouse, also capable of reducing energy consumption.
For achieving the above object, the technical scheme that the present invention takes is: a kind of high-wetness frostless cool house, include refrigeration compressor set, air-cooler, and refrigeration compressor set is communicated with air-cooler, air-cooler is arranged in the freezer, it is characterized in that also including liquid storage tank, circulating pump, shower etc.Liquid storage tank is arranged on the bottom in the freezer, be placed with low freezing point solution in the liquid storage tank, liquid storage tank is provided with and leads to freezer outer charge door, filling opening and leakage hole, the inlet of circulating pump puts in low freezing point solution in the liquid storage tank by pipeline, the liquid outlet of circulating pump by pipeline be arranged on freezer in the air-cooler upside, and can the shower that air-cooler and freezer internal perisporium spray be communicated with.
Because liquid storage tank can be stored a large amount of low freezing point solution, cold storage capacity is big, and low freezing point solution both can prevent the evaporimeter frosting of air-cooler by through circulating pump, shower air-cooler and freezer perisporium being sprayed, can improve the humidity in the freezer to humidification in the freezer again.Low freezing point solution concentration in the liquid storage tank can be regulated by charge door, filling opening, and is easy to adjust.
For large-scale freezer, the freezer bottom area is bigger, liquid storage tank can be designed to two pool structures, be about to liquid storage tank and can be divided into work pool and regulating reservoir, be provided with valve between work pool, regulating reservoir and circulating pump, charge door and filling opening are communicated with regulating reservoir, and leakage hole is communicated with work pool, regulating reservoir is by valve, the concentration that just can regulate the low freezing point solution in the work pool.Regulate more convenient like this.Also can between work pool and regulating reservoir, be provided with the adjusting gap, in general, the liquid level of work pool is lower, the liquid level of regulating reservoir is higher, and the high concentration low freezing point solution in the regulating reservoir flows in the work pool by regulating gap, can play autoregulation to a certain degree, the time between but twice Open valve of proper extension regulated, reduce the unlatching number of times of valve, can reduce number of operations, help saves energy, increase the service life.
Therefore to have the storage liquid measure of low freezing point solution big in the present invention, and cold storage capacity is big, and the concentration adjustment of low freezing point solution is convenient, and the air-cooler evaporimeter does not have frosting, good refrigeration effect, humidity height in the storehouse, characteristics such as also capable of reducing energy consumption.

Five, the specific embodiment
Accompanying drawing 1 is one embodiment of the present of invention, and it includes refrigeration compressor set, air-cooler 1, and refrigeration compressor set is communicated with air-cooler 1, and air-cooler 1 is arranged in the freezer 2, also includes liquid storage tank 3, circulating pump 4, shower 5 etc.Liquid storage tank 3 is arranged on the bottom in the freezer 2, be placed with low freezing point solution in the liquid storage tank 3, liquid storage tank 3 is provided with charge door 6, filling opening 7 and the leakage hole 8 that leads to outside the freezer 2, the inlet of circulating pump 4 puts in low freezing point solution in the liquid storage tank 3 by pipeline, the liquid outlet of circulating pump 4 by pipeline be arranged on freezer 2 in air-cooler 1 upsides, also can the shower 5 that air-cooler 1 and freezer 2 internal perisporiums spray be communicated with.
Because liquid storage tank 3 can be stored a large amount of low freezing point solution, cold storage capacity is big, and low freezing point solution both can prevent the evaporimeter frosting of air-cooler 1 by spraying through circulating pump 4,5 pairs of air-coolers 1 of shower and freezer 2 perisporiums, can improve the humidity in the freezer 2 to humidification in the freezer 2 again.Low freezing point solution concentration in the liquid storage tank 3 can be regulated by charge door 6, filling opening 7, and is easy to adjust.
Accompanying drawing 2 is embodiments of the invention two, applicable to large-scale freezer 2, because large cold storage 2 bottom areas are bigger, liquid storage tank 3 can be designed to two pool structures, be about to liquid storage tank 3 and can be divided into work pool 9 and regulating reservoir 10, be provided with between work pool 9 and regulating reservoir 10 and regulate gap 11, be provided with valve 12 between work pool 9, regulating reservoir 10 and circulating pump 4, valve 12 can adopt magnetic valve.Valve can be provided with two, is separately positioned between regulating reservoir 10, work pool 9 and the circulating pump 4, also can be communicated with (as shown in Figure 2) between two valves.Charge door 6 and filling opening 9 are communicated with regulating reservoir 10, and leakage hole 8 is communicated with work pool 9, the concentration that regulating reservoir 10 can directly be regulated the low freezing point solution in the work pools 9 by two valves and adjusting gap 11.Also can through circulating pump 4, shower 5, the low freezing point solution concentration of spray be controlled, regulate the concentration of low freezing point solution in the work pool by the flow of two valves 12 of control.Regulate more convenient like this.
Therefore to have the storage liquid measure of low freezing point solution big in the present invention, and cold storage capacity is big, the concentration of low freezing point solution Easy to adjust, the air-cooler evaporimeter does not have frosting, good refrigeration effect, and humidity height in the storehouse, also capable of reducing energy consumption etc. Characteristics.
